For spoons Len's early in the year (I like #0 white/anything) and later in the year Mepps Cyclops when I am using spoons.
Though big pike not as not big bait focused as something like a muskie it does not hurt to throw big baits. For the most part, I use either big soft plastics or big plugs both in the 6" range. The soft plastics are a slower presentation than the big plugs I usually burn in. I find high speed plugs useful during the early summer "they lost their teeth" stage.
Up on Dorey, I have found that there is almost no topwater bite but in the warmer Alberta lakes, there is a topwater bite. Have other folks who fish colder northern lakes found that too?
So topwater like Buzz baits, whopper plopers, I will be doing more topwater when I am fishing Alberta lakes this year. So I will be adding walk the dog type plugs, standard poppers, and jitterbugs.
